Output fabffa7fdf36d14cf9b76d1a4e1ec853af5e2b9b69a13cf0b3bbdec96d93e107:1

value
999496736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1889d0e28aeead58cdb384b7e6a481e819ad81 OP_EQUAL
address
38ifMGY9rp9xXjX5xkpSRta5BPVZjciJ58
transaction
fabffa7fdf36d14cf9b76d1a4e1ec853af5e2b9b69a13cf0b3bbdec96d93e107
confirmations
534677
spent
true